Description
The 3300 XL 8 mm Proximity Probe (330101-00-77-15-02-05) is a high-precision eddy current transducer engineered for industrial automation, predictive maintenance, and real-time monitoring of rotating machinery. It generates an output voltage proportional to the distance between the probe tip and a conductive surface, enabling accurate measurements of both static position and dynamic vibration. This makes it ideal for fluid-film bearings, turbines, compressors, and pumps where reliability and precision are critical.
This version features a 7.7-inch overall case length with 0-inch unthreaded length, accommodating installations where a longer probe body is required. Its 3/8-24 UNF threaded case ensures secure mounting, while the 1.5-meter (4.9-foot) miniature coaxial ClickLoc cable allows seamless integration with standard 3300 XL Proximitor systems. The probe is certified for use in hazardous environments under CSA, ATEX, and IECEx approvals and operates reliably in extreme temperatures from -52°C to +177°C (-62°F to +350°F).
Key technical specifications include a 2 mm (80 mils) linear range, 50 Ω output resistance, supply sensitivity under 2 mV per volt, and 69.9 pF/m extension cable capacitance, ensuring stable signal transmission. The patented TipLoc design strengthens the bond between probe tip and body, while CableLoc technology provides 330 N (75 lbf) pull strength, securing the cable against mechanical stress. Optional FluidLoc cables prevent oil or liquid ingress, ensuring probe reliability and reducing maintenance needs. Fully backward-compatible with 3300 series 5 mm and 8 mm probes, the system enables easy upgrades without recalibration.
Applications
1. Radial Shaft Vibration Monitoring
Measures radial displacement with precision up to 2 mm, enabling detection of imbalance, bearing wear, or misalignment in turbines and compressors.
2. Axial Position Tracking
Monitors axial (thrust) movement in fluid-film bearings to prevent overload and maintain optimal pump and turbine performance.
3. Keyphasor Signal Generation
Provides accurate phase reference for vibration analysis and rotor balancing, critical for predictive maintenance programs.
4. Hazardous Area Operation
Certified for CSA, ATEX, and IECEx, allowing safe deployment in oil, gas, and chemical environments.
5. Compact Installation in Restricted Spaces
The probe’s 7.7-inch length accommodates tight mounting areas while maintaining high measurement fidelity.
